Slide out problems or not? Noise
In my Wildwood T25KS, the kitchen slide out is starting to make very a very loud scraping noise during the first 7 inches ouf outward movement. The slide is electric motor powered. When bringing the slide out back into the trailer, it operates as normal in that it starts in, travels for a period of movement, then tilts slightly up fopr the last foot or so of inward movement.. BUT when extending it out, the minute you depress the out button, the slide drops down and starts it outward movement. It is during this first 7 inches or outward movement that a very, very loud wood scraping noise is heard then it goes away as it continues out. I was able to determine that the front ottom of the slide out stove frame is what is scraping the vinyl floor for this first 7 inches or so. It makes plenty of noise but has yet to mark the floor. This has just started happening so something has changed but what? Is there an adjustment for this or something I should look into?
